Tag: Jeff Giesea

Stop Calling People Out

Stop Calling People Out Jeff Giesea October 24, 2014 Pretend that you occasionally lose your temper in meetings, and my aim is to get you

Read More »
You will now be redirected to our Career Portal.

The link will open in a separate browser tab.